应用高可用服务

快速提高应用高可用能力

应用高可用服务(Application High Availability Service)是一款专注于提高应用高可用能力的SaaS产品,提供应用架构自动探测,故障注入式高可用能力评测和一键流控降级等功能,可以快速低成本的提升应用可用性。

我们的优势

自动感知架构
自动探测应用的架构组件和依赖关系,构建架构拓扑并持续跟踪变化
智能识别组件
覆盖主流的三方组件和大部分阿里云服务,通过AI不断学习架构特征
全面演练高可用能力
来自线上真实的故障类型和演练模板,全方位评测应用的高可用能力
成熟的高可用防护手段
历经双十一等技术大考的流控降级保护等防护手段,确保应用万无一失

精心打造的功能

  • 架构可视化

    第三方组件

    自动感知识别Redis,Mysql,ZooKeeper等常用的三方组件

    云服务

    自动感知识别云数据库RDS版,云数据库Redis版,SLB,OTS等常用阿里云云服务

  • 高可用评测

    自动推荐

    基于自动感知的架构,智能推荐演练场景来评测其高可用能力

    演练库

    不断积累的基于真实故障场景的演练库

  • 高可用防护

    支持主流框架

    支持针对HTTP,JDBC,Dubbo,RESTful,RedisClient等主流框架的流控降级

    自定义防护接口

    通过SDK可以自定义流控降级的接口,支持个性化的流控降级需求

常见使用场景

  • 传统应用高可用
微服务高可用

微服务高可用

一键托管式微服务高可用能力提升

针对基于SpringCloud,Dubbo或K8S的微服务应用,一键快速接入高可用能力,无需改造代码,无需运维后台服务。

能够解决

  • 微服务流控

    应对突发的流量洪峰,保护微服务稳定

  • 微服务降级

    应对服务依赖引发的雪崩问题,提高整体应用的稳定

传统应用高可用

传统应用高可用

快速无成本接入高可用能力

针对传统单体或分布式应用,提供一种无需开发侵入和改造的快速获得应用高可用的能力,已上线的应用也可以方便的接入应用高可用服务。

能够解决

  • 业务入口限流

    对突发的业务流量和异常访问进行流控

  • 数据库访问保护

    隔离各类业务对数据库的调用,保护重要业务